index
:
archsetup.git
init-install-work
main
builds a full dev workstation from a bare Arch Linux install.
Craig Jennings
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
archsetup
Age
Commit message (
Expand
)
Author
19 hours
fix(archsetup): code cleanup and style fixes
Craig Jennings
19 hours
fix(archsetup): bug fixes, locale support, and code improvements
Craig Jennings
43 hours
prune(archsetup): remove valent package
Craig Jennings
45 hours
refactor(archsetup): improve code architecture and error handling
Craig Jennings
48 hours
prune(archsetup): remove podman, use docker for distrobox
Craig Jennings
48 hours
prune(archsetup): remove redundant and unused packages
Craig Jennings
48 hours
prune(archsetup): remove unused packages
Craig Jennings
48 hours
fix(archsetup): add btrfs detection, don't assume non-ZFS is btrfs
Craig Jennings
2 days
feat(archsetup): add config file support for unattended installs
Craig Jennings
2 days
refactor(archsetup): remove --skip-slow-packages flag
Craig Jennings
2 days
fix(archsetup): improve error reporting and desktop database setup
Craig Jennings
2 days
fix(archsetup): add PAM config for gnome-keyring auto-unlock
Craig Jennings
2 days
feat(archsetup): add additional gstreamer codec packages
Craig Jennings
2 days
refactor(archsetup): remove jdk, racket, and foliate packages
Craig Jennings
2 days
refactor(archsetup): replace texlive-meta with minimal package set
Craig Jennings
2 days
fix(archsetup): enable syncthing user service via symlink
Craig Jennings
2 days
fix(archsetup): fix dbus-broker race condition with sysusers
Craig Jennings
2 days
fix(archsetup): enable ufw firewall with ufw enable command
Craig Jennings
2 days
fix(archsetup): use modalias for GPU detection instead of lspci
Craig Jennings
3 days
fix(archsetup): add system config improvements and gnome-keyring setup
Craig Jennings
3 days
fix(archsetup): run update-desktop-database after stow
Craig Jennings
4 days
fix(archsetup): add firewall validation with critical warning
Craig Jennings
4 days
fix(archsetup): add locale configuration
Craig Jennings
4 days
fix(archsetup): replace ntp with chrony and add packages
Craig Jennings
4 days
fix(claude-code): use native installer instead of npm-global
Craig Jennings
4 days
fix(archsetup): increase GRUB timeout and switch syncthing to user service
Craig Jennings
5 days
fix(archsetup): prevent ZFS boot failures and add validation tests
Craig Jennings
5 days
fix(archsetup): remove unnecessary firewall ports
Craig Jennings
5 days
feat(archsetup): skip avahi if already running
Craig Jennings
6 days
fix(archsetup): remove root account locking
Craig Jennings
6 days
fix(archsetup): redirect git clone output to logfile
Craig Jennings
6 days
fix(archsetup): fix npm global install and add wireless-regdb
Craig Jennings
6 days
fix(archsetup): start systemd-resolved before creating DNS symlink
Craig Jennings
6 days
feat(archsetup): configure Docker to use ZFS storage driver on ZFS systems
Craig Jennings
6 days
feat(archsetup): add claude-code AI coding assistant
Craig Jennings
6 days
fix(archsetup): use official repo packages for tailscale and torbrowser
Craig Jennings
6 days
fix(archsetup): fix ZFS scrub timer and emacs clone
Craig Jennings
6 days
fix(archsetup): move STARTTIME outside intro() for resume support
Craig Jennings
6 days
feat(archsetup): add --no-root-lock flag for testing
Craig Jennings
6 days
fix(archsetup): add harfbuzz dependency for st terminal
Craig Jennings
6 days
fix(archsetup): fix DNS and git safe.directory for curl|bash
Craig Jennings
6 days
fix(archsetup): clone repo instead of copying for curl|bash support
Craig Jennings
6 days
fix(archsetup): chown tmpfs mount point instead of parent dir
Craig Jennings
7 days
feat(archsetup): add automatic console login for encrypted systems
Craig Jennings
7 days
feat(archsetup): add wireguard-tools and tailscale
Craig Jennings
7 days
docs(archsetup): note potential Docker DNS issue with systemd-resolved
Craig Jennings
7 days
privacy(archsetup): add encrypted DNS (DNS over TLS)
Craig Jennings
7 days
privacy(archsetup): add WiFi MAC address randomization
Craig Jennings
7 days
feat(archsetup): add lynis security auditing tool
Craig Jennings
7 days
feat(archsetup): configure journald retention to 500MB
Craig Jennings
[next]